Letter Writing

Email to a professor who doesn't know me.

HI, I"m sending an email to a professor who doesn't know about me to ask about her research that I'm reading. Please help me correct this draft. I put blanks or the letters in some scientific phrases. THank you.

I'm an undergraduate student who is supposed to give a presentation on a scientific paper and I decided to go with one of the papers written by you, titled __________ . I have some questions about that research that I hope you will give it a brief answer or hint.

My first question is, one of the highlight findings is that ___A__. How is that finding different from the other two, which are that B and that C ? I think these two findings are enough to conclude that A.

I also have to come up with some limitations for the study. I think one of them could be not ____. I don't have much deep knowledge about immunology so please correct me if there are any things wrong. I would appreciate it if you could spend time helping me with those questions. Bests,XX.
  

Top answer

My first thought is that you are asking this professor to do a lot for you. I think you need to add a great deal more politeness to this email. My second thought is that she is unlikely to spend time helping an undergraduate she does not even know with one of his assignments.

  • My first thought is that you are asking this professor to do a lot for you.
  • I think you need to add a great deal more politeness to this email.
  • My second thought is that she is unlikely to spend time helping an undergraduate she does not even know with one of his assignments.
  • Finally, I think you need to add information about what your major field of study is.
  • And what university you are attending.
